Cleaning uPVC windows

Cleaning uPVC windows repairs to upvc windows can be an easy process, however it is important to make sure that you use the proper tools and materials. This will help prevent the buildup of dust and moisture from damaging your uPVC windows.

First take care to clean your uPVC windows. You can accomplish this by using a brush or a soft cloth, dipped in the soapy water of a bucket.

After you have removed all the debris, it's time to remove the frame from the uPVC. It is advised to avoid using any liquids, chemicals or abrasive cleaning products when cleaning uPVC. They could cause irreparable harm. Instead, choose a non-abrasive cleaning product that is dilute with water.

You can also clean your uPVC window sills. This requires assistance from a professional. Additionally, you should avoid scratching your uPVC. Use a soft-nozzle brush.

It is recommended to spray paint uPVC when it has been stained. These spray paints come in a variety of colors and can provide an outstanding finish. These are an excellent alternative if you're looking to restore your uPVC windows.

You may also find a quality uPVC solvent cleaning product in your local hardware store. Diluted uPVC cleaners with water are the most secure. Be sure not to accidentally scratch the glass using the cleaner.

After you've finished cleaning, you'll have to dry the window with a non-abrasive cloth. Then , you can polish the glass using a microfiber cloth.

If you're trying to keep your uPVC window frames in good shape, you should try to clean them at least twice per year. In addition to that, if they're situated near trees, you may require having them cleaned more frequently.

Keeping your uPVC doors and windows in good condition will assist to increase the value of your home. It will make it less necessary to spend money on repairs by keeping them clean and maintained. Your home can be protected from moisture and mould by maintaining your uPVC windows clean.

uPVC windows last a long time

The life span of uPVC windows can vary from 20 to 35 years depending on the quality of the window. However, the average life span is between 20 and 25 years. Regular maintenance can prolong the lifespan of UPVC windows.

The life span of UPVC windows can be affected by the quality of the raw materials employed. Windows made from low quality materials could last as little as five years. To avoid this, be sure to examine the product's pigmentation. A low level of pigmentation could be an indication that the product isn't containing enough UV-resistant ingredients.

Other factors that may affect the life span of a uPVC product include a inadequate installation. A poorly installed UPVC product could fail to be watertight, and may also be exposed to corrosion.

uPVC is known to withstand extreme weather conditions. However, it is not as durable as aluminium. It is susceptible to damage in the event of excessive heat present or if it is subjected to high humidity.

As with all types of window, a UPVC window will require to be replaced at some point. Choose a reputable company when you want to buy uPVC windows. This will ensure you get an excellent product.

Condensation is another factor that can impact the life expectancy of an UPVC window. It is possible to prevent condensation through thermal pumping, however it's not always possible. If condensation is present this means there is an issue. Therefore, it is important to keep your windows clean.

The location of your house will also affect the duration of your uPVC windows. The coastal areas are more prone to saltwater that is acidic. Although the acidic saltwater may not have a significant impact on the durability of the uPVC window, it could cause some damage to the internal steel structure.

No matter if you live in a coastal area or not the quality of your UPVC windows is vital to their longevity. Quality uPVC windows make use of pure virgin vinyl resin and are specifically designed to stop cracking.

UPVC windows offer many advantages over wooden windows. They are also economical. They are also environmentally friendly and can be recycled once they are installed.
